The Physiological Influence of Worry
Whenever we encounter a stressor, our bodies activate the "combat-or-flight" response, triggering a cascade of hormonal improvements. The adrenal glands release cortisol and adrenaline, elevating heart rate and hypertension even though diverting Power to muscles and clear of techniques considered quickly unnecessary. This reaction, when essential for survival in really hazardous scenarios, gets problematic when chronically activated.
Research has connected persistent strain to numerous overall health circumstances:
Cardiovascular Program: Continual stress contributes to hypertension, atherosclerosis, and improved possibility of coronary heart assault and stroke. The continuous elevation of anxiety hormones damages blood vessel linings and encourages inflammation, accelerating the development of heart problems.
Immune Functionality: Extended tension suppresses immune reaction, building folks far more at risk of bacterial infections and slowing wound therapeutic. Experiments demonstrate stressed people working experience more frequent diseases and choose for a longer time to Recuperate.
Digestive Wellness: The gut-brain relationship means tension instantly impacts digestive function, contributing to circumstances like irritable bowel syndrome, acid reflux, and ulcers. Tension alters gut microbiome composition, likely influencing In general wellbeing.
Metabolic Outcomes: Pressure hormones raise blood glucose degrees and endorse fat storage, significantly within the abdomen. This raises danger for type two diabetes and metabolic syndrome.
Mind Structure and Function: Serious strain truly reshapes the brain, enlarging the amygdala (anxiety Middle) while shrinking the prefrontal cortex and hippocampus, spots very important for memory, selection-creating, and psychological regulation.
Snooze Disruption: Tension commonly interferes with snooze good quality and duration, developing a vicious cycle as sleep deprivation more elevates anxiety hormones.
Accelerated Getting older: Exploration suggests Serious tension damages telomeres, the protective caps on chromosomes, probably accelerating mobile ageing and age-similar conditions.

How Psychologists Support Take care of Worry
Psychologists specialise in understanding the complicated interplay in between ideas, emotions, behaviors, and physical well being. Their instruction equips them to supply numerous evidence-primarily based methods for tension management:
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T): This method assists determine and modify thought styles that add to strain. By recognizing cognitive distortions—like catastrophizing or all-or-almost nothing imagining—persons figure out how to reframe scenarios in more well balanced strategies. CBT also incorporates behavioral approaches to produce more healthy responses to stressors.
Mindfulness-Primarily based Interventions: Mindfulness practices coach awareness to target the present instant devoid of judgment. Tactics like mindfulness meditation have already been shown to lower cortisol stages, reduce hypertension, and increase immune perform. Psychologists can instruct these techniques and aid clients combine them into daily life.
Biofeedback: This method utilizes checking gadgets to deliver true-time suggestions about physiological procedures like heart amount, muscle pressure, and skin temperature. Using this awareness, men and women learn to manage these functions, cutting down the physical manifestations of worry.
Tension Inoculation Schooling: This proactive strategy prepares individuals to manage annoying scenarios by way of education about pressure, talent-constructing, and guided observe. It really is specially efficient for men and women struggling with predictable stressors.
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T): ACT aids persons accept unavoidable stressors although committing to steps aligned with own values. This method lowers the extra struggling that emanates from fighting towards conditions outside of a person's control.
Social Help Enhancement: Recognizing the strong buffer influence of social connections, psychologists assistance clients reinforce help networks and increase interaction techniques.
Way of living Modifications: Psychologists work with customers to apply wellness-selling behaviors like standard exercising, balanced diet, sufficient sleep, and time management—all very important for worry resilience.
